unprotect specfic cells in worksheet
Hi,
With protection off, select the cells you want to unprotect and then choose the command Format, Cells, Protection tab, and uncheck Locked. Then reprotect the sheet. If this helps, please click the Yes button Cheers, Shane Devenshire "ND at sib" <ND at wrote in message ... |
